Title: Act of War Series: ----- Author: Dale Brown Rating: 3 of 5 Stars Genre: Thriller Pages: 432 Synopsis: The United States gets nuked. With the potential for more. A military science geek has been working on a powered exoskeleton for infantry and gets his chance to showboat. However, sinister forces lurk in the background and may bring ruin and mayhem to all that Americans hold most dear [ie, themselves]. Act of war takes readers deep into the new world of intelligence-focused warfare, and introduces a new hero: 32-year-old army engineer Jason Richter, designer of a whole array of futuristic infantry weapons and devices to hunt down a new breed of enemy. His unlikely partner is FBI Special Agent Kelsey Cornell, a no-nonsense intelligence officer who is caught between two brutal worlds: the terrorists who kill without remorse and Richter's high-tech military hunter-killers who will stop at nothing to destroy them. As the head of a top-secret military unit, code-named Task Force TALON, Richter must lead his group against a cabal of international terrorists backed by a powerful consortium who are determined to destabilize the global economy.
